Poetry and wrestling are two things that most people usually don害羞草研究所檛 associate with one another, but on May 17, these two vastly different worlds will collide at the害羞草研究所檚 害羞草研究所楽ummer Slam害羞草研究所.
The Laurel Packinghouse will play host to the brainchild event of the Inspired Word 颁补蹿茅, an organization committed to showcasing the talent of local poets through a series of fun and inclusive events, such as Thursday night害羞草研究所檚 wrestling/poetry hybrid.
害羞草研究所淪ummer Slam is an old wrestling event, and so we thought it would be fun to have an event that had the fun and performativity of a wrestling event and the lyrical competition of a poetry slam.害羞草研究所 said Summer Slam co-organizer, Cole Mash.
害羞草研究所淭his event isn害羞草研究所檛 like anything else you will see in Kelowna,害羞草研究所 continued Mash. 害羞草研究所淚WC has moved into the realm of interdisciplinarity, utilizing the skills of our incredible team of poets and performers to put on a great show.害羞草研究所
The event features a line-up of eight local poets, hand-picked by organizers, who will battle it out with their words, while leaving the wrestling displays to the professionals.
17 year-old Maddie Bishop is the youngest competitor at this year害羞草研究所檚 competition. She caught the eye of organizers by performing at various open-mic nights over the past few years, and is very excited to have been invited to this year害羞草研究所檚 slam, which is expecting crowds in the neighbourhood of a few hundred.
害羞草研究所淚t害羞草研究所檚 an honour to be competing against these amazing poets,害羞草研究所 said Bishop. 害羞草研究所淚t feels like I害羞草研究所檓 playing in the big leagues of Kelowna now, and it害羞草研究所檚 very exciting.害羞草研究所
